F2 (Fun2)
Even more Fun to fly! Changes include: Added nose
nappy, mylar pocket with mylar inserts an option,
a new sail cut rim & fill style
with load bearing heavier cloths, a different luff
curve. New crossbar junction and base bar hardware
that allows interchange for carbon bar etc. The
airfoil has been refined with improved reflex bridle
attachement. Hinged battens and a new easy to install
tip strut.

V-Lite/f2T
20.5hp Polini Two Stroke engine
The V-Lite/f2T complies with Australia's sub 70
kg category, this means that hang glider pilots
only need a simple motorised endorsement to fly
one. Another advantage is the f2 wing used on the
V-Light can also be used as a foot launch hang glider.
The Polini engine is a perfect fit offering excellent
